The page describes logic for a controller, and an evocation to use the boards 
in a daisy chain mode.
Given a high level program, and the need,
this  could be worked up to:
 - a conveyor belt being notified of a new part placed at its entrance,

  *   A robot gets notified the conveyor belt has a port for it to put into a 
lathe / mill / treatment furnace,
  *   A lathe / mill / furnace tells the robot the part is to be inspected,
  *   An inspection machine tells the robot that the part is    no / go  and is 
ready for packaging and exit conveyor / rework,

as a work cell.
